#Viagra #newborns #brains #lacked #oxygen Sildenafil could reduce the severity of the after-effects of newborns who lacked oxygen during pregnancy or at birth, shows a study led by a doctor at the Montreal Children’s Hospital. Newborns with neonatal encephalopathy are usually treated with therapeutic hypothermia, the only option used to prevent brain damage in such […]
